Celebrating the Black Experience Art Exhibit Launches Kentucky Tour 

The Kentucky Arts Council launches the Celebrating the Black Experience touring art exhibit this July. The fifth annual exhibit, presented by the Kentucky Center for African American Heritage (KCAAH), includes mostly Kentucky artists and some from Indiana, Florida, Massachusetts, Benin and Zimbabwe. Governor’s Derby Exhibit is now open!

Governor’s Derby Exhibit is now open!

The 2025 Governor’s Derby Exhibit is now open in the Capitol Rotunda in Frankfort. The work of 44 artists from across Kentucky, curated by the Kentucky Arts Council, will be on display through May 29. The exhibit, which carries the theme “Spring is Here,” opened April 30.
